søndag den 7. november 2021 kl. 11.41.35 UTC+1 skrev Frank Jørgen Jørgensen: > When I compile the bank application in the PolyORB or my own DSA application I get an error referring to a-sttebu.ali which I suspect is something new in GNAT 2021 to handle the improved 'Img functionality in Ada 202X. a-sttebu.ali is the package Ada.Strings.Text_Buffers (.ali), which is a recent invention [1]. It is not part of FSF 10.3.0 or FSF 11.2.0. > I am guessing that the issue here is that the PolyORB is not up to date with GNAT 2021 compiler, or have I missed something in installation? I do not know why it is needed by your application. Jesper [1] https://learn-staging.adacore.com/courses/ada_2022_whats_new/chapters/image_redefine.html#
Jesper Quorning <jesper.quorning@gmail.com> writes: > [1] > https://learn-staging.adacore.com/courses/ada_2022_whats_new/chapters/image_redefine.html# Most of us can't see this (but looking forward!). In the meantime, see the 202x ARM A.4.12: http://www.ada-auth.org/standards/2xrm/html/RM-A-4-12.html

I encountered the exact same problem today, except on arch linux,
rather than windows.
After much stabbing in the dark, the chase for several wild gueese,
playing option roulette and moving files around, I found this
'workaround' ...
In the folder from which po_gnatdist is invoked ...
$ cp /us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/13.2.1/adainclude/a-sttebu.ads .
$ mkdir --parents dsa/x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u/obj
$ cp /us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/13.2.1/adalib/a-sttebu.ali
dsa/x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u/obj/
Obviously, this is only a temporary fix. I'll try to send a bug
report to the polyorb issues area on github and hope the problem is able
to be resolved by the experts.
